Nettetfor 1 dag siden · Pre-Christian History of Baptism. Prior to John the Baptist, water was often used for cleansing. Regular cleansing, of course, but also for ritual cleansing. The association of water with spiritual cleanliness was not unknown to society from the first civilization, Mesopotamia, onwards. In Mesopotamia, water was first sanctified and then ...

Matthew 3. See more. fit for work declarationNettetThe name John is primarily a male name of Hebrew origin that means God Is Gracious. John is one of the most common names in English. It ultimately derives from the Latin name Iohannes, which comes from the original Greek form of the name.
